When identifying the perfect glove, two materials often :dominate:emerge: nitrile and latex. Each offer unique properties that cater to various applications. Latex gloves are known for their comfort, making them ideal for precise operations. However, latex can cause allergic reactions in some individuals. Nitrile gloves, on the other hand, deliver superior protection, positioning them a reliable choice for handling hazardous materials.
Ultimately, the best choice depends on the specific needs of your activity.

The Science Behind Nitrile Gloves: Material Properties and Performance
Nitrile gloves have become ubiquitous in various sectors, offering a reliable barrier against chemicals. This popularity stems from their unique material properties that contribute to superior protection. Essentially made from acrylonitrile butadiene rubber (NBR), nitrile gloves exhibit exceptional strength against a wide range of substances.
The molecular structure of NBR grants nitrile gloves their inherent adaptability. This allows for comfortable and precise handling, even during lengthy use. Furthermore, nitrile's non-porous nature prevents the penetration of harmful substances, creating a secure barrier between the wearer's skin and potential threats.
Consequently, the combination of these material properties makes nitrile gloves an indispensable tool in diverse applications, ranging from medical procedures check here to industrial maintenance.
